Job Summary

The Production Scheduler manages and supports all production-related activities.

Job Responsibilities

  • Work closely with Sales, Purchasing, Production and Dispatch to generate and distribute daily production schedules to achieve delivery commitments.
  • Utilize ERP system capabilities for production scheduling.  Create and verify Bills-of-Materials for standard and custom products.
  • Communicate production lead times to all levels of the organization.
  • Schedule all stock and custom products based on form capacity, manpower availability and min/max inventory levels.
  • Parodically review Min/Max inventory levels and adjust based on sales history.
  • Coordinate the movement of stock inventory to the appropriate plant location or distribution center with Dispatch.
  • Identify potential material shortages and take appropriate action to minimize their effect.
  • Establish inventory cycle counting process for raw materials and finished goods inventories. 
  • Participate in the physical inventory process.
  • Lead weekly sales & operations planning meetings.

Job Requirements

The requirements listed below are representative of the knowledge, skills and abilities required.  Reasonable accommodations may be made to enable qualified individuals with disabilities to perform the essential duties of the job.

  • Bachelor’s Degree or a minimum of two (2) years manufacturing experience in lieu of degree.  Experience in the precast concrete industry preferred.
  • Interpersonal skills and the ability to establish and maintain effective relationships throughout the organization.
  • Experience with change management initiatives related to processes and procedures to achieve desired results.
  • Customer focus; dedicated to meeting the expectations of internal and external customers.
  • Excellent oral / written communication, presentation and listening skills.
  • Strong analytical skills, excellent computer skills (Microsoft Word, Excel, Outlook) and experience with MRP, production scheduling, inventory control.
  • Ability to plan work and implement programs through the direction of others.
  • Ability to read and understand shop/engineering drawings.
